[cpif] r322 - trunk/frontend-web

svn at argo.es svn at argo.es
Wed Aug 1 16:15:30 CEST 2007


Author: jcea
Date: Wed Aug  1 16:15:29 2007
New Revision: 322

Log:
Gestion correcta de OpenID cuando entramos a traves
de un proxy apache, por ejemplo.



Modified:
   trunk/frontend-web/url_LOGIN.py

Modified: trunk/frontend-web/url_LOGIN.py
==============================================================================
--- trunk/frontend-web/url_LOGIN.py	(original)
+++ trunk/frontend-web/url_LOGIN.py	Wed Aug  1 16:15:29 2007
@@ -1,6 +1,6 @@
 # $Id$
 
-from globales import monitor,openid_support
+from globales import monitor,openid_support,base_url
 
 def gestiona_url(handler,path,usuario) :
   import database
@@ -44,7 +44,7 @@
         if get_openid(usuario_form,OpenID_form) :
           from openid.consumer import consumer
           from url_LOGIN_OpenID import sessions,create_new_state
-          servidor="http://"+handler.headers["host"]+"/"
+          servidor=base_url+"/"
           rnd,sesion=create_new_state(usuario_form,"/"+"/".join(path))
           oidconsumer=consumer.Consumer(sesion,sessions)
           try :



More information about the cpif mailing list